Transaction 99f19d8bf62d15b71dfcf26e7c09ab4a4ae77c3fcdbe67e97ee03838819f2901
1 Input
1 Output
-
99f19d8bf62d15b71dfcf26e7c09ab4a4ae77c3fcdbe67e97ee03838819f2901:0
- value
- 754323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caf53776a78a6055bc18b9e23d0d849aeacae036 OP_EQUAL
- address
- 3LCABFBZ3Fgje578jzKCM65aVYfx8oK91e